- DISCONNECT FLOOR SHIFT TRANSMISSION CONTROL SELECT CABLE (for TMC Made)
- Move the shift lever to N.
- Disconnect the floor shift transmission control select cable from the transmission floor shift assembly.
- Rotate the lock nut counterclockwise approximately 180° and, while holding the lock nut in that position, disconnect the floor shift transmission control select cable from the transmission floor shift assembly.
*a Counterclockwise NOTE:Do not forcibly pull the floor shift transmission control select cable into the cabin.
- DISCONNECT FLOOR SHIFT TRANSMISSION CONTROL SELECT CABLE (for TMMMS Made)
- Move the shift lever to N.
- Disconnect the floor shift transmission control select cable from the transmission floor shift assembly.
Disconnect in this Direction - Using a screwdriver, pull out the stopper of the floor shift transmission control select cable.
*a Stopper NOTE:Do not remove the stopper. If it is removed, reinstall it to its original position.
- Rotate the nut counterclockwise approximately 180° and, while holding the nut in that position, disconnect the floor shift transmission control select cable from the transmission floor shift assembly.
*a Stopper *b Nut Disconnect in this Direction NOTE:- Do not rotate the nut excessively as the interior spring may come off and the floor shift transmission control select cable will not be reusable.
- Do not forcibly pull the floor shift transmission control select cable into the cabin.
- REMOVE TRANSMISSION FLOOR SHIFT ASSEMBLY
- Remove the 4 bolts and separate the transmission floor shift assembly.
- Disconnect the transmission control switch connector.
- Disengage the 3 clamps to separate the wire harness from the transmission floor shift assembly.
- Disconnect the shift lock control ECU connector.
- Disengage the 2 clamps to separate the wire harness from the transmission floor shift assembly.
- Remove the transmission floor shift assembly.
